Simply put it is the drive that puts the winning team ahead for the last time, confined to the fourth quarter or overtime.
QB goes 8-8 on a drive ending with a 12 yard, game winning TD pass with 7 seconds left? Game winning drive.
QB hands off on the first play of the fourth quarter to the running back who runs for a 75 yard touchdown with 14:45 left that ends up being the final score of the game? Also a game winning drive.
In isolation the GWD says zero about the QBs performance. The QB can have everything, or nothing, to do with it.

As others have pointed out, "come-from-behind" or "game-winning drives" actually aren't a good criteria. They indicate a team finds its trailing or tied often.

The 1992-1995 Cowboys, and Aikman, had very few deficit-overcoming or game-winning drives, due to usually being dominant.
